# Ledgerbee Environments

Hey, new folks! Ledgerbee (our billing worker) runs blue-green: two identical stacks, and we flip traffic once the idle one passes invoice smoke tests. Flips happen Tuesdays unless finance says otherwise. Both colors share the queue but not the cache. The green stack currently runs with these configuration values.

deployment values, yadug-bawif:
[framir]
team = pelox
access_code = ac_a38ab2
owner = tamion.julael
host = framir.tolvaqlabs.test
port = 11211
peer = tammir.zemvargrid.local
salt = 2215ef03
pin = 1541

**☐ Brief new starter on weekend lift maintenance.** The facilities desk must explain that Ashfell Plaza runs lift servicing every Sunday morning, meaning the main cars are offline from 06:00 to noon. Confirm the starter knows the route to the west stairwell, including the fire-door signage on level 2, and note that the goods lift is staff-only during this window. Issue the weekend stairwell pass code, which should be recorded below.

badge for yagep-fahog: bdg-HBHYH-29021

# Break-Glass Access — Fabrikoon Test-Data Factory

Contractors: normal use of Fabrikoon never needs elevated rights. Break-glass applies only when the seed registry is corrupted and on-call is unreachable. Steps: declare an incident in the Larkspur tracker, page the data steward, then open the emergency console. All break-glass sessions are recorded and reviewed within 24 hours. Misuse revokes contractor access. The emergency console accepts the recovery passphrase below.

strongbox words: gilok-druion-briath-wendor-briion-prawyn-fenion-oliir-casdor-holius-briius-gilath-gilael-pelys

Shrinkray CLI — environments. Plugin authors should know that Shrinkray runs three environments: sandbox, beta, and prod. Sandbox accepts any image source and skips quota checks; beta mirrors prod limits. Plugins are loaded identically across all three, so behavior differences come only from configuration. The sandbox resizer workers start with the settings given below.

settings of tagef-bawif:
DRUIX_HOST=druix.zemvarlabs.internal
DRUIX_PORT=8000